Milwaukee School of Engineering invites applications for multiple faculty positions at the Assistant or Associate Professor level for Fall 2021 teaching in the Mechanical Engineering Program.

The full-time faculty positions are open to applicants in all areas of Mechanical Engineering; however, preference will be given to applicants with expertise in the areas of, Thermal Science/Fluids, Computational Mechanics and Dynamics, or Mechatronics.

These positions require an earned doctorate in Mechanical Engineering (or a related field), relevant experience, and a strong interest in effective undergraduate teaching, integrating theory, applications and laboratory practice.  Candidates are expected to have an undergraduate engineering degree from an ABET-accredited program. In addition to teaching duties, successful candidates will be expected to become involved with academic advising, course/curriculum development, supervision of student projects, and continued professional growth through a combination of consulting, scholarship, and research.  Excellent communication skills are required.
